Coinbase Secures UK License to Expand Into Stocks and Derivatives

Coinbase has obtained UK regulatory approval to offer stocks and derivatives, marking its largest product expansion in a key international market. The Financial Conduct Authority granted the exchange a MiFID license, enabling it to provide traditional financial instruments beyond cryptocurrencies for the first time in the UK.

Retail users will gain access to equity trading, while institutional and advanced traders can trade derivatives, including crypto, equity, and commodity perpetual futures. The move aligns with Coinbase’s strategy to become an “everything exchange,” competing with brokerages and fintech platforms globally.

The UK authorization complements Coinbase’s existing e-money and crypto licenses, positioning it as one of the most regulated crypto firms in the market. The approval comes as Britain finalizes its broader crypto regulatory framework.
